Frequently Asked Questions about Las Vegas
How much are Studio apartments in Las Vegas?
There are currently 876 Studio Apartments in Las Vegas with rent ranges from $470 to $9,277 with an average price of $1,342.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Las Vegas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Las Vegas ranges from $329 to $17,028 with an average monthly rent of $1,559.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Las Vegas c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Las Vegas range from $810 to $13,129.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,782.
How expensive are Las Vegas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 747 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Las Vegas on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$944 to $16,481 - averaging $2,069 for the location.
